On Thu, Mar 13, 2014 at 04:17:55PM -0400, Vivek Goyal wrote:
> On Thu, Mar 13, 2014 at 04:06:49PM -0400, Vivek Goyal wrote:
> > On Thu, Mar 13, 2014 at 12:58:14PM -0700, Andy Lutomirski wrote:
> > > On Thu, Mar 13, 2014 at 12:53 PM, Vivek Goyal <vgoyal-H+wXaHxf7aLQT0dZR+AlfA@public.gmane.org> wrote:
> > > > On Thu, Mar 13, 2014 at 10:55:16AM -0700, Andy Lutomirski wrote:
> > > >
> > > > [..]
> > > >> >> 2. Docker is a container system, so use the "container" (aka
> > > >> >> namespace) APIs. There are probably several clever things that could
> > > >> >> be done with /proc/<pid>/ns.
> > > >> >
> > > >> > pid is racy, if it weren't I would simply go straight
> > > >> > to /proc/<pid>/cgroups ...
> > > >>
> > > >> How about:
> > > >>
> > > >> open("/proc/self/ns/ipc", O_RDONLY);
> > > >> send the result over SCM_RIGHTS?
> > > >
> > > > As I don't know I will ask. So what will server now do with this file
> > > > descriptor of client's ipc namespace.
> > > >
> > > > IOW, what information/identifier does it contain which can be
> > > > used to map to pre-configrued per container/per namespace policies.
> > >
> > > Inode number, which will match that assigned to the container at runtime.
> > >
> >
> > But what would I do with this inode number. I am assuming this is
> > generated dynamically when respective namespace was created. To me
> > this is like assigning a pid dynamically and one does not create
> > policies in user space based on pid. Similarly I will not be able
> > to create policies based on an inode number which is generated
> > dynamically.
> >
> > For it to be useful, it should map to something more static which
> > user space understands.
>
> Or could we do following.
>
> open("/proc/self/cgroup", O_RDONLY);
> send the result over SCM_RIGHTS
I guess that would not work. Client should be able to create a file,
fake cgroup information and send fd.
